Traditional additive manufacturing (also known as 3D printing) of continuous carbon fiber reinforced plastic (CCFRP) lacks the ability to manufacture parts with high speed and energy efficiency. This is mainly because of the contact needed and the slow heat transfer from the conventional hotend to the composite filaments.

What is Carbon DLS ™ Carbon DLS ™ is a resin-based polymer process that uses light and heat to create parts with isotropic properties complex geometries and excellent surface finishes. DLS offers a wide range of production-grade materials allowing engineers to build end-use parts right off the printer.

The aim of this research was to determine the influence of the short carbon fibres in nylon PA6 polymer used for fused deposition modelling (additive manufacturing) technology. Specimens from pure PA6 and PA6 with short carbon fibres were fabricated with both main directions of the material with respect to the build orientation in a 3D printer.

· adidas has today launched its latest running shoe made with Carbon s Digital Light Synthesis 3D printing technology.. The 4DFWD is the result of four years of collaboration between the two companies and combines decades of adidas athlete data with Carbon s additive manufacturing process to create a midsole that pushes runners forward.
